FOREIGN MINISTER RECEIVES AFGHAN AND IRANIAN DEPUTY FOREIGN MINISTERS

 

Foreign Minister Shah Mahmood Qureshi received today Afghan Deputy Foreign Minister Mohammad Kabir Farahi and Iranian Deputy Foreign Minister Mohammad Mehdi Akhoundzadeh along with  members of their respective delegations who attended the Senior Officials Meeting of Afghanistan-Iran-Pakistan Trilateral Summit process in Islamabad today. The Foreign Minister welcomed them and expressed the hope that the Trilateral Summit process initiated on the sidelines of the Economic Cooperation Organization (ECO) Summit in Tehran in March 2009 would be vigorously pursued, focusing on our common vision for peace, security, stability and prosperity of our region. 

Foreign Minister Qureshi emphasized that the challenges of terrorism, extremism, drugs, human trafficking and trans-border organized crimes that our region is facing could only be dealt with through a comprehensive regional approach anchored in mutual respect and mutual interest.   The Foreign Minister added that our three countries have suffered immeasurably because of conflict and instability.  In order to overcome our common problems, we need to join hands and embark upon sustained cooperative engagements on bilateral, regional and trans-regional planes. 

The Deputy Foreign Ministers of Afghanistan and Iran reiterated their commitment to making the Trilateral Summit process result-oriented, agreeing on the need to focus on the issues of security and development simultaneously.
